Meeting notes — Tilewarden prefetcher review. The team confirmed the map-tile prefetcher now respects the bandwidth cap on metered connections, and cache eviction follows the new LRU-with-pinning scheme. Two edge cases remain: zoom-level transitions during pan, and stale tiles after region updates. Both are tracked and slated for the 4.2 release candidate. QA sign-off is expected by Thursday. For the release gate, the accountable engineer is listed below.

account owner for bawip-tahag: Raleth Quenok

Subject: Tracewire cut-over — we're live!

Hi support crew,

Quick recap: we flipped the switch on Tracewire last night, so all requests across the Pondhollow microservices now carry end-to-end trace IDs. If a customer reports a slow checkout, you can pull the full trace instead of guessing which service ate the time. Spans from legacy services show up tagged "bridged" — that's expected.

Here's the config the gateway is running with right now.

service settings:
PRAIX_LOG_LEVEL=error
PRAIX_METRICS_HOST=metrics.praix.qorvelcorp.corp
PRAIX_POOL_SIZE=16

Quick orientation before Thursday's sync: LiftLab simulates dispatch strategies for the fictional Harrowfield tower (40 floors, 6 cars). The interesting knobs are SIM_TICK_MS (keep at 100 unless profiling), PASSENGER_SPAWN_RATE, and DISPATCH_STRATEGY — `nearest-car` is the baseline, `zoned` is what we're demoing. Runs are reproducible if you pin SIM_SEED, so please do that before sharing results. The simulator pushes run metrics to the shared results board, which needs an upload credential in your env file. Add this line:

secret setting of fawep-tagaf: ARCHIVE_KEY3=ce5

Subject: StockTally cut-over summary

Team, the StockTally inventory reconciliation job cut over to the new scheduler Tuesday night. We drained the legacy queue first, verified zero in-flight batches, then flipped traffic. Two retries fired during warm-up but reconciled cleanly; counts matched the warehouse ledger within tolerance. Marta will monitor through Friday. For the sync, the active configuration values are listed below.

settings of bawif-fawif:
ralix:
  log_level: warn
  metrics_host: metrics.ralix.tolvaqsys.internal
  pool_size: 32